In software growth, there are numerous phases, consisting of requirement evaluation and code review. Common programs languages are made use of in the development procedure. The demands evaluation step is crucial to the development process, and also must not be ignored. Without an accurate needs analysis, it is not feasible to develop high quality software. It is very important to understand the needs of the software prior to starting a project. Using demands evaluation methods, programmers can boost their effectiveness and reduce development time. Keep reading to find out more about software application development phases and approaches. In the event you loved this information and you want to receive more info with regards to www.adsm.com.sg assure visit the web page.
Stages of software advancement
There are various stages that take area during the software advancement process. Each phase calls for a considerable quantity of time and resources. The end result ought to be an useful and also testable software application option. Software screening is done during this stage by quality control experts or system analysts. The goal of software application testing is to determine insects or errors. This process ought to be detailed and not rushed. It likewise involves applying a software release approach. If you are unclear of which phase of software application growth your job remains in, continue reading for more information about every one.
Common programs languages
There are a number of shows languages offered today. Some are utilized for software advancement, while others are utilized for graphics and also computer animation. Java, for instance, has actually been around given that the start of the World Wide Internet. It is utilized for web growth to enhance internet sites and add interactive capacities. An additional popular shows language is C, which is a general-purpose shows language that works as a base for other languages. C++ is an extra intricate variation of C, as well as it complements C. Other languages are procedural, which are based upon data checking out ranges and are frequently utilized for clinical and also commercial applications. JavaScript and also Perl are both examples of procedural languages.
Techniques utilized to develop software program
There are a number of different methods for developing software program. The Falls approach is one example. This approach contains one lengthy development stage adhered to by smaller stages. It likewise needs a lot of paperwork as well as is not appropriate for big groups. However, it is often made use of when a software project needs to be easily changed after it has been launched. A major benefit of this method is that it is less expensive and easier to manage. The falls approach requires a huge number of designers to finish a job, however if a smaller sized group needs to function in a regulated atmosphere, this method might be the very best alternative.
Requirements evaluation
The software program advancement cycle finishes with the entry of the task to the customer and also the production of a program direction manual. Before the procedure begins, the software growth team must conduct a thorough requirements evaluation to identify and also comprehend the certain demands. This will certainly aid them prepare the task’s range, duration, as well as sources, as well as will avoid any surprises. Right here are some suggestions on just how to do a demands evaluation. These pointers will aid you obtain started on your software growth project.
Requirements spec
A demand specification is a record that defines the preferred functions of an item. This document is typically a high-level description of a software system. The designer’s goal is to develop an item that meets these needs. A requirement spec is an important part of the software program development process. Without an appropriately documented requirement, a software program growth task can not be successful. This record can be handy to developers as well as software application testers, as it assists them comprehend the product and develop the correct examination cases and also scenarios. If you liked this report and you would like to receive additional facts about site kindly go to our own internet site.
Even more recommendations from encouraged publishers: